1. Determine the Issue
Before proceeding with repairs, recognize the particular issue with the window handle. Is it loose? Stuck? Broken? Understanding the nature of the problem will help figure out the necessary steps.
2. Gather Tools
Collect all the tools and materials listed above. This preparation will simplify the repair work process.
3. Eliminate the Handle
To fix or change a window handle, start by removing it:
Use a screwdriver to unscrew any screws holding the handle in place.If the handle is stuck, carefully wiggle it as you unscrew to loosen it.4. Examine the Mechanism
When removed, examine the internal system for indications of wear, rust, or debris. Clean the area utilizing a cleansing cloth to get rid of dust or grime.
5. Lubricate Moving Parts
If the handle is functioning badly due to tightness, use a lube to the internal system. This can enhance motion and lengthen the handle’s life.
6. Replace Broken Parts
If any parts of the handle are broken or missing out on, change them with brand-new parts. Make certain to use suitable replacements to make sure appropriate performance.
7. Reattach the Handle
Align the handle back onto the system and firmly screw it back into place. Ensure it is tight enough to prevent wobbling however not so tight that it blocks motion.
8. Check the Handle
Before concluding the repair, test the handle’s operation numerous times to guarantee it runs efficiently without any hitches.

How often should I check my window manages?
It’s recommended to examine window manages every 6 months to catch any potential issues early on.
2. Can I replace a window handle myself?
Yes, replacing a window handle is a simple process that many homeowners can do themselves with standard tools.
3. What kinds of lubes are best for window handles?
Silicone spray or graphite powder is perfect given that they do not attract dirt and dust.
